a composite cytokine consiting of CLF-1 [Cytokine-like factor-1] and CLC [cardiotrophin-like cytokine] that preferentially interacts with the CNTF receptor and activates the gp130 signal transducer (Elson et al, 2000; Plun-Favreau et al, 2001). The factor is sometimes being referred to as CNTF II.
Forger et al (2003) have demonstrated that this heterodimeric cytokine binds to CNTF receptor-alpha and enhances the survival of developing motoneurons in vitro and in vivo.
